REDDITCH Council has passed proposals for a shared single management team with Bromsgrove District Council.
Full council voted through the recommendations of the shared services board at an extraordinary meeting on Monday.
The council ratified changes made as a result of consultation, having agreed to sharing a management team back in July.
The new single management team should be in place early in 2010.
Because sensitive information relating to individuals was being discussed as part of these proposals, the public could not be present at the meeting.
